Output 23a52fb8cae39e06f2decc701a12c26f5656537484963f0394697f1e77f041fe:0

value
8362776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b90e0abc17cd7a1aeb07848ead0697789b23de OP_EQUAL
address
M8EqwqoHHaWJVXMD5nr5XKyeuvuxncG5ur
transaction
23a52fb8cae39e06f2decc701a12c26f5656537484963f0394697f1e77f041fe
spent
true